On Wed, 2006-02-22 at 13:35 -0600, John O'Laughlin wrote:

> At present the only way to set up a board position is by putting words
> on the board and committing them.  It would be some work to do it and
> get the score correct.  It wouldn't be difficult at all to have a real
> board-editor, but we haven't done it yet.

Hey, the score is always correct if you make the game a two-player game
with two human controllers. Just make sure one player always makes your
play and one player always makes your oppo's play. Quackle keeps score
for you.

Notice that you can double click on a position in the history table to
jump back to reanalyse a past position.
